Daily Briefing in Relation to the Military Coup

Description: 

"As of 18 June, (870) people are now confirmed killed by this junta coup. AAPP compiled and documented (5) fallen heroes today. These (5) fallen heroes from Pauk Township in Magway Region, Myingyan Township in Mandalay Region and Shwepyitha Township in Yangon Region were killed on previous days and documented today. This is the number verified by AAPP, the actual number of fatalities is likely much higher. We will continue adding as and when. As of 18 June, a total of (4983) people are currently under detention; of them (186) are sentenced. 1937 have been issued arrest warrants; of them 31 were sentenced to death and 14 to three years imprisonment with hard labour, 39 to 20 years imprisonment with hard labour and 5 to 7 years imprisonment with hard labour, who are evading arrest. We are verifying the recently released detainees and continuing to document. A total of 38 villagers from Kwansite Village in Mandalay Region’s Myingyan Township were arrested after a former USDP Chairman was stabbed on June 15 at Kwansite Village. Sein Win and Chit Ko, two villagers, were killed on June 16 from torture in interrogation. On June 16, Naing Lin Tun a.k.a. Naung Thurein, Magway University Student, was sentenced to three years imprisonment with hard labour under Section 505(A)-c of the Penal Code by the court in Magway Prison. In addition to this, Thet Naing Win, a freelance reporter, was sentenced to three years imprisonment under Section 505(a) of the Penal Code by the court in Tharrawaddy Prison on June 16.
